C&D did a comparison test between the two in the March 2006 issue. The SRT8 cleaned the SS's clock in every performance test, but in the end the SS walked away the winner in this C&D test, because the SS was still a Sport Ute that still has some ute, and nice performace to go with it. Where as the SRT8 was all performance and no ute. If I had the mag in front of me I would quote the "Got To Have-It Factor" since its been quite a few times that is has came down to the points awarded in this section that decides the winner, anybody remember the GTO vs Mustang
And this one was close under there points system only one or two points difference.
0 to 60 was 4.5 seconds vs 5.5 seconds, 1/4 mile are 13.2 sec. vs 14.1 sec. and the margin widens as it goes up.
So why doesn't the LS2 perform closer to what the 6.1 Hemi does. The LS2 on paper is only 25hp shy (395hp vs 420hp) and the SRT8 is heavier, could it all be in the extra gear the SRT8 has to play with vs the old 4-speed auto in the SS?
